Output 8ef244f72f2161e59826aa80479092c44c1d70ee06d8431f43b33bd92faa2a8d:129

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 833da7beae9d1b74540d34a9b2e98357e8f34e2773bed7cea219b797f723e00c
address
bc1psv76004wn5dhg4qdxj5m96vr2l50xn38wwld0n4zrxme0aeruqxqx034vn
transaction
8ef244f72f2161e59826aa80479092c44c1d70ee06d8431f43b33bd92faa2a8d
spent
true